Hornady V-Match – loaded with ELD-VT projectiles that are so accurate that you might just decide to use them for precision target shooting. The ELD-VT showcases the drag-standardizing and dispersion-minimizing performance of the DVRT meplat, which itself is part of the deformation-proof Heat Shield polymer tip. The ELD-VT additionally features a long, sleek profile with a lead core that distributes its weight rearward, as well as a flawless AMP jacket and boat tail.
That’s a whole heaping pile of accuracy-boosting features. They add up to give the 80 grain ELD-VT a G7 BC of 0.206, which stands for the following performance out of a 24” barrel:
0yds: 3,300 fps | 1,935 ft lbs | -1.5”
100yds: 3,063 fps | 1,666 ft lbs | 2.9”
200yds: 2,833 fps | 1,426 ft lbs | 3.7”
300yds: 2,614 fps | 1,214 ft lbs | 0.0”
400yds: 2,404 fps | 1,027 ft lbs | -8.7”
500yds: 2,203 fps | 862 ft lbs | -23.5”
600yds: 2,011 fps | 719 ft lbs | -45.4”
The ELD-VT would be bad enough news to varmints if it were only laser-accurate. The fact that it blows itself apart into jagged lead and copper fragments on impact, even at lower velocities? Well, that’s even worse news to varmints.
